    EP:103 | Now That’s a Giant Snake

    This week we learn from Ian Bartoszek, a biologist with The Conservancy of SW Florida, where he describes the recent capture of an 18 foot, 217 pound Burmese python in the Florida Everglades and more. Ian and his staff have dedicated their lives to protecting the Everglades from this invasive species, and so far have removed an astonishing 26,000 pounds of these snakes. The stories are crazy! Later, retired Mississippi biologist Jim Lipe, tells the random story of how he was bitten by a cottonmouth, causing his arm to swell to the size of his leg.     EP:100 | Insight into Oak Masting and More with Dr. Marcus Lashley

    This week on the Gamekeepers podcast we welcome one of our favorite guests, Dr. Marcus Lashley (@DrDisturbance), from the University of Florida. We begin by discussing summer scouting for desirable plant species, while many are blooming and easier to identify PLUS how to gauge them as indicator species. We also give a tip on an app or two that can help a Gamekeeper ID them. The presence of these plants or lack thereof can be important information to a Gamekeeper. Marcus also explains a recent study on “oak masting,” and how this information can help improve your hunting. It’s commonly thought that many trees of the same species synchronize and drop their mast/acorns at the same time, but the study shows some interesting insights.     EP:98 | No-Till Without a Drill

    This week on the podcast we dive deep into more efficient methods of establishing plantings for wildlife, without having to till the soil. Methods such as Throw-and-Mow and Frost or Snow Seeding are increasing in popularity because it’s easy, cheaper, better for soil health and ultimately the critters. The use of implements such as roller-crimpers are explained as a way of cutting back on herbicide use and improving growing conditions. Gamekeeper Magazine Editor-in-Chief and our Northern food plot specialist, Todd Amenrud, and his uncle and incredibly knowledgeable hunting buddy, Dave Medvecky, share their successes with these planting methods.     EP:97 | Managing For World Record Bluegill

    This week on the podcast we talk about growing big bream. Really big bream, copper nose bluegills over three pounds to be more exact. Guest Sarah Parvin has proven she and her dad can grow three pounders regularly. She tells how and explains the project she and her father started to grow a world record bream in North Alabama. Their pond is called the Slab Lab and it’s impressive. Also retired fisheries scientist and founder of American Sportfish Hatchery, Don Keller joins us to tell us the science behind the Copper Nose Bluegill and the waters that produce giants.
